IFAT China 2006 coming up

IFAT China 2006 held 27 "“ 30 June offers a broadly structured accompanying program. This examines the entire spectrum of areas relevant to environmental protection in Asia: from water supply, sewage treatment and waste disposal to recycling, air pollution control and environmental technology right down to environmentally compatible forms on energy in Asia.

At the event Chinese and international experts will discuss and report on innovations, developments and trends in the environmental industry in over 100 events. The subjects include:

  • the water market in China, water supply networks
  • membrane technology
  • waste management
  • renewable energy
  • sewage sludge and biogas
  • control of air pollution.

The companies at IFAT China can demonstrate their products and services to the audience from the trade. Apart from the technical and scientific accompanying program, there is also a series of special events.

For example, an Environmental Special is dedicated to the provinces of Guangdong and Shangdong and the Free State of Bavaria. The regions will be presenting their environmental protection programs and innovations in environmental technology. In a round of discussion, high-ranking political representatives of the provinces will converse with Bravarian environment minister Dr. Werner Schnappauf about points of view and prospects in environment protection.

In the Asia Special, the countries of China, Japan and Korea are the centre of attention. For these markets, a series of technical talks, rounds of discussion and exhibitor presentations are offered.

The BHI Design Institute Day is a platform for planners, designers, management and the authorities. It facilitates the exchange of expert knowledge in combining modern, sophisticated architecture with environmental technology. Here interested exhibitors can meet representatives of design institutes and the Chinese authorities and speak about scientific as well as technical cooperation.

"With this accompanying program, IFAT China 2006 offers a broad, solid and solution-oriented forum for the Asia environmental industry "“ a podium for a transfer of expertise, networking and business contacts," said Eugen Egetenmeir, member of the managing board of Messe Munchen.
